Output 889adb31c2dc24d0e86c31d727f04bfc2c876288751995627867c124ccd21653:17

value
51335763
script pubkey
OP_0 OP_PUSHBYTES_20 6aa8107fdfceb6b750e62a8df834345dae76ed3a
address
ltc1qd25pql7le6mtw58x92xlsdp5tkh8dmf6kutkde
transaction
889adb31c2dc24d0e86c31d727f04bfc2c876288751995627867c124ccd21653
spent
true